July Weather in Kingston, United States

Last updated: June 24, 2025

In July, the average temperature in Kingston, United States is a pleasant 25°C (77°F). Expect a range where the minimum can dip to 14°C (57°F), while the maximum may reach up to 34°C (94°F). Throughout the month, 109 mm (4.3 in) of precipitation is likely to fall over 12 days, contributing to a relatively high average humidity of 81%.

How July Weather in Kingston Compares to Other Months

Weather in Kingston varies notably across the year, with each month offering distinct climate conditions. This page compares July’s weather to other months in Kingston, focusing on differences in temperature, rainfall, humidity, and UV levels.

This table compares monthly weather conditions in Kingston, showing how July’s temperature, precipitation, humidity, and UV index levels differ from those of other months.
 TemperaturePrecipitationHumidityUV
January Weather0°C (33°F)81 mm (3.2 inches)88%moderate
February Weather2°C (37°F)109 mm (4.3 inches)88%moderate
March Weather7°C (44°F)123 mm (4.8 inches)87%high
April Weather12°C (53°F)126 mm (5.0 inches)85%very high
May Weather18°C (65°F)127 mm (5.0 inches)81%very high
June Weather22°C (73°F)130 mm (5.1 inches)82%very high
July Weather25°C (77°F)109 mm (4.3 inches)81%very high
August Weather24°C (75°F)91 mm (3.6 inches)73%very high
September Weather21°C (70°F)91 mm (3.6 inches)73%very high
October Weather15°C (59°F)102 mm (4.0 inches)78%high
November Weather6°C (43°F)96 mm (3.8 inches)89%moderate
December Weather3°C (38°F)104 mm (4.1 inches)87%moderate
